Company Info
Shenzhen Botrs Electronics Co. , Ltd. Shenzhen Botrs Electronics Co. , Ltd.

Street Address: A 6/F, Building A7, Xiufeng Industrial Park, Buji Street, Longgang

City: Shenzhen

Province: Guangdong

Country/Region: China

View Contact Details